They shrieked. ( Exodus 2 v 23 - 25 )


        After 400yrs of suffering in Egypt things did not improve ,the wicked Pharaoh died and
        a new one ruled,they may have thought that things would improve,but it didn't.A Motyer
        writes,''They had a new king  , but still the old sorrows''. So what could they do?,well here
        is what they did,''The  Israelites groaned in their slavery and cried out,and their cry for
         help, because of their slavery went up to God'',and then we read, God heard (Exodus
        2 v 23- 24)   A/ M points out,they shrieked,and God heard,we read in James 5 v 17, that
        Elijah prayed earnestly,when our Lord was in the garden,we read in Luke 22 v 44,''And
        being in anguish he prayed more earnestly,and his sweat was like drops of blood falling
        to the ground''So many of us pray dead prayers,formal, and unemotional ,have we ever
        shrieked to God,how earnest is our prayers?.Could it be that our  unanswered prayers ,
        are a result of our lack of earnestness. We all have a lot to to learn about prayer,and one
        thing we need to know is that  the effectual  fervent prayer of a righteous man avails
       much ,or as J .B.Phillips puts it,''tremendous power is made available through a good
       man's earnest prayer.( James 5 v 17 )

                                                              James 5 v 17- 18
                                      Elijah was a man just like us,he prayed earnestly
                                      that it would not rain on the land for three and a
                                      half years. Again he prayed,and the heavens gave
                                      rain,and the earth produced its crop.
